    Didn't get get to it this weekend, was chasing a rough idle issue all weekend. Ended up being fuel starvation because my transfer fuel pump wasn't pumping. Thought I fixed it when I pulled all the plugs I installed yesterday and found one I forgot to gap. Drove out and stopped at autozone, bought a jack, tapped on the pump and it started working again. But I was a dummy and didn't unplug it before reinstalling and the brittle plug broke. I don't let things like that stop me, so I scraped back and melted away some of the plastic on the pump side and the plug side and soldered in some wire to jumper it. Sealed it with 2 coats of liquid electrical tape and no more worries there.
